Solana built its reputation on raw speed. That promise helped the network attract developers, traders, and large-scale applications that needed fast confirmation and low fees.

A closer look at Hedera introduces a serious comparison that changes the conversation around performance and reliability across major blockchains.

Crypto analyst Bmendo highlights this contrast in a detailed post that focuses on Hedera’s sustained throughput and deterministic settlement.

His breakdown explains why consistent execution may matter more than headline transaction numbers when institutions evaluate blockchain infrastructure for payments, tokenization, and identity systems.

Hedera Speed And Finality Create A Different Performance Standard

Bmendo explains that Hedera sustains more than 10,000 transactions per second in real conditions. This figure stands far above Bitcoin and Ethereum base layer capacity.

Solana reports very high theoretical throughput, yet real network conditions often show lower sustained performance. Cardano presents a more conservative design with slower confirmation certainty.

Finality introduces the strongest distinction. Hedera transactions settle within 3 to 5 seconds with mathematical certainty. Confirmation cannot be reversed once validated.

Many competing chains rely on probabilistic settlement that requires additional waiting time before confidence becomes absolute. Enterprise systems value certainty because financial transfers and record management cannot tolerate rollback risk.

Enterprise Utility Strengthens Hedera Position Against Solana And Cardano

Bmendo connects technical performance to real-world deployment. Stable throughput prevents congestion spikes during heavy demand. Fixed and predictable fees allow organizations to estimate operating costs without sudden volatility.

Immediate settlement enables cross-border payments, automated supply chain logging, and machine-driven microtransactions that execute without delay.

Solana continues to offer strong developer activity and fast execution. Cardano maintains a research driven framework with careful upgrades.

Hedera introduces a model that combines speed, certainty, and operational stability in one environment. This combination aligns closely with enterprise compliance and service level expectations.

Bmendo also points to valuation context. Hedera’s market capitalization near $4B appears modest when compared with networks that deliver lower confirmed throughput or slower settlement assurance.

Performance alone never determines valuation. Adoption, liquidity, and ecosystem depth still shape long-horizon outcomes.

Performance leadership can influence future capital allocation if institutional usage expands. Payment infrastructure, tokenized assets, and identity verification systems require reliability more than speculative excitement.

Hedera positions itself directly inside that requirement set, which creates a meaningful competitive narrative against Solana and Cardano.
